excel怎么粘贴不用调行高

excel怎么粘贴不用调行高

在Excel中粘贴内容而不调整行高,可以通过以下方法:使用“选择性粘贴”、使用“格式刷”、调整粘贴选项、利用VBA宏。其中,使用“选择性粘贴”是最常用且便捷的方法,可以避免因为粘贴内容而导致行高发生变化。这些方法不仅可以节省时间,还能确保表格的美观和一致性。接下来,我们将详细介绍每一种方法的具体操作步骤及其优缺点。

一、使用“选择性粘贴”

1.1 什么是选择性粘贴

选择性粘贴是Excel中一个非常强大的功能,它允许用户选择性地粘贴某些特定的内容或格式,而不是全部内容。这可以包括值、公式、格式、注释等。

1.2 如何使用选择性粘贴

  1. 复制数据:首先,选择并复制你想要粘贴的单元格或区域。
  2. 选择目标单元格:接下来,右键点击你想要粘贴数据的目标单元格。
  3. 选择性粘贴选项:在右键菜单中,选择“选择性粘贴”。在弹出的对话框中,你可以选择只粘贴值或其他特定的内容。

1.3 优缺点

优点

  • 灵活性强:可以选择只粘贴需要的内容,避免不必要的格式变化。
  • 操作简单:不需要复杂的操作步骤,几乎所有用户都能轻松掌握。

缺点

  • 需要手动操作:在处理大量数据时,可能需要重复多次操作。

二、使用“格式刷”

2.1 什么是格式刷

格式刷是Excel中的一个工具,它允许用户将一种单元格的格式复制到另一个单元格。这对于保持统一的格式非常有用。

2.2 如何使用格式刷

  1. 选择源单元格:首先,选择一个具有你想要应用格式的单元格。
  2. 激活格式刷:点击Excel工具栏中的“格式刷”按钮。
  3. 应用格式:然后点击你想要应用该格式的目标单元格。

2.3 优缺点

优点

  • 便捷:只需几步操作即可完成格式复制。
  • 快速:适用于小范围的格式调整。

缺点

  • 范围有限:一次只能复制一种格式,不能同时复制多种格式。

三、调整粘贴选项

3.1 什么是粘贴选项

粘贴选项是Excel在粘贴内容时提供的一系列选项,可以帮助用户更精确地控制粘贴内容的格式和方式。

3.2 如何调整粘贴选项

  1. 复制数据:选择并复制你想要粘贴的内容。
  2. 粘贴数据:在目标单元格右键点击并选择“粘贴选项”。
  3. 选择适当选项:选择你需要的粘贴选项,如“只粘贴值”、“保持源格式”等。

3.3 优缺点

优点

  • 多样性:提供多种粘贴选项,满足不同需求。
  • 灵活性:用户可以根据具体需求选择合适的粘贴方式。

缺点

  • 复杂度高:对于初学者来说,可能需要一些时间来熟悉各种选项。

四、利用VBA宏

4.1 什么是VBA宏

VBA(Visual Basic for Applications)是Excel中的一种编程语言,可以用来自动化各种操作。通过编写宏,可以极大地提高工作效率。

4.2 如何编写和使用VBA宏

  1. 打开VBA编辑器:按下“Alt + F11”打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,选择“插入”->“模块”。
  3. 编写代码:在模块中编写VBA代码。例如:

Sub PasteValuesWithoutChangingRowHeight()

Dim targetRange As Range

Set targetRange = Selection

targetRange.PasteSpecial Paste:=xlPasteValues

End Sub

  1. 运行宏:选择你需要粘贴内容的单元格区域,然后运行宏。

4.3 优缺点

优点

  • 高效:适用于大量数据的处理,能极大地提高工作效率。
  • 自动化:减少手动操作的繁琐。

缺点

  • 学习成本高:需要掌握VBA编程知识,对于不熟悉编程的用户来说,可能有一定的难度。

五、总结

在Excel中粘贴内容而不调整行高,可以通过使用“选择性粘贴”、使用“格式刷”、调整粘贴选项、利用VBA宏等方法。每种方法都有其优缺点,用户可以根据具体需求选择最合适的方法。例如,选择性粘贴适用于大多数情况,因为它操作简单且灵活;格式刷适合小范围的格式调整;调整粘贴选项提供了更多的选择,但可能需要一些时间来熟悉;而利用VBA宏则是处理大量数据的高效选择,但需要一定的编程知识。通过合理选择和使用这些方法,可以确保在粘贴内容时保持行高不变,提升工作效率。

相关问答FAQs:

1. 如何在Excel中粘贴内容时避免调整行高?

  • 问题:在Excel中粘贴内容时,如何确保行高不会被调整?
  • 回答:要避免Excel粘贴时调整行高,可以尝试以下方法:
    • 在粘贴之前,先调整目标单元格的行高,确保它足够高以容纳要粘贴的内容。
    • 使用“粘贴选项”功能,选择“只粘贴数值”或“只粘贴格式”,以防止Excel自动调整行高。
    • 在粘贴之后,可以手动调整行高,而无需自动调整。

2. Excel中如何避免粘贴内容导致行高调整不均匀?

  • 问题:在Excel中,我发现粘贴内容后,行高调整得不均匀,如何解决这个问题?
  • 回答:若发现Excel粘贴内容后导致行高调整不均匀,可以尝试以下方法:
    • 在粘贴之前,将目标单元格的文本格式设置为“自动换行”,这样可以确保粘贴的内容适应单元格大小。
    • 使用“粘贴选项”功能,选择“只粘贴数值”或“只粘贴格式”,以避免Excel自动调整行高。
    • 如果行高调整不均匀,可以手动调整行高,选择相邻行的行高一致,以确保整个表格的外观一致。

3. 如何在Excel中粘贴内容时保持原始行高不变?

  • 问题:我想在Excel中粘贴内容,但希望保持原始行高不变,有什么方法可以实现吗?
  • 回答:若想在Excel粘贴内容时保持原始行高,可以尝试以下方法:
    • 在粘贴之前,先选择目标单元格,右键点击并选择“格式单元格”,在“对齐”选项卡中取消勾选“自动调整行高”。
    • 使用“粘贴选项”功能,选择“只粘贴数值”或“只粘贴格式”,以避免Excel自动调整行高。
    • 如果Excel仍然自动调整行高,请手动调整行高,以恢复到原始行高。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4539219

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部